老年人的邻里环境与社交网络变动

Neighborhood Conditions and Social Network Turnover among Older Adults.

Abstract

Increasing research highlights heterogeneity in patterns of social network change, with growing evidence that these patterns are shaped in part by social structure. The role of social and structural neighborhood conditions in the addition and loss of kin and non-kin network members, however, has not been fully considered. In this paper, we argue that the residential neighborhood context can either facilitate or prevent the turnover of core network relationships in later life - a period of the life course characterized by heightened reliance on network ties and vulnerability to neighborhood conditions. Using longitudinal data from the National Social Life, Health, and Aging Project linked with data from the American Community Survey, we find that higher levels of neighborhood concentrated disadvantage are associated with the loss of older adults' kin and non-kin network members over time. Higher levels of perceived neighborhood social interaction, however, are associated with higher rates of adding non-kin network members and lower rates of adding kin network members over time. We suggest that neighborhood conditions, including older adults' perceptions of neighborhood social life, represent an underexplored influence on kin and non-kin social network dynamics, which could have implications for access to social resources later in the life course.

摘要

越来越多的研究凸显了社交网络变化模式的异质性,越来越多的证据表明,这些模式部分是由社会结构塑造的。然而,社会和邻里结构条件在亲属和非亲属网络成员增减方面所起的作用尚未得到充分考虑。在本文中,我们认为居住社区环境在晚年可能促进或阻碍核心网络关系的更替,晚年是人生历程中的一个阶段,其特点是对网络关系的依赖增强,且易受社区环境影响。利用来自“全国社会生活、健康与老龄化项目”的纵向数据,并结合美国社区调查的数据,我们发现,随着时间的推移,邻里集中劣势程度越高,老年人亲属和非亲属网络成员流失的可能性就越大。然而,随着时间的推移,邻里社交互动感知水平越高,增加非亲属网络成员的比例就越高,而增加亲属网络成员的比例则越低。我们认为,社区环境,包括老年人对邻里社交生活的感知,对亲属和非亲属社交网络动态的影响尚未得到充分探讨,这可能会对人生后期获得社会资源产生影响。
